Gone From my Sight

  I am standing upon the seashore. A ship spreads her white sails to the morning breeze and starts for the blue ocean. 

She is an object of beauty and strength. I stand and watch her until at length she hangs like a speck of white cloud just where the sea and sky come to mingle with each other.

Then, someone at my side says: “There, she is gone!”

“Gone where?”
Gone from my sight. That is all.  She is just as large in mast and hull and spar as she was when she left my side and she is just as able to bear her load of living freight to her destined port. Her diminished size is in me, not in her.

And just at the moment when someone says, “There, she is gone!” there are other eyes watching her approach and other voices ready to take up the glad shout:
“Here she comes!”
And that is dying.

– Henry Van Dyke, a 19th Century clergyman, educator, poet, and religious writer

What’s in a boat name?

“Kaikiwi” was featured in a cruising magazine. The article went on to say: “Recently, I put out a call for your favourite boat name and the reason behind it. Capt Gaelyn shared the story of “Kaikiwi”, her Beneteau 411. Capt Gaelyn was born and raised in New Zealand before finding the warmer waters of Hawaii to sail as a charter boat captain. What does “Kaikiwi” mean? Kai in Hawaiian means salt water. Kiwi is the fond nickname for a New Zealander. That makes a simple and unique boat name that summarises the experiences of Captain Gaelyn.”

Because this is custom sailing, we can sail any time of day you want and whatever length of time you wish. Our islands are most consistently graced with trade winds so any time is a good time to go sailing…✨SUNRISE, morning, afternoon, SUNSET✨.  It is all good. A client this week was concerned if we left at 0800 for a 3-hour sail we wouldn’t have enough wind. So much sailing, anywhere in the world, relies on the afternoon seabreeze. The fact is, we rely on tradewinds and not sea/land breezes. This makes Hawaii sailing unique and desirable, ANY TIME OF DAY. His concern was also the mid-day heat. “Kaikiwi” has lots of shade, so, time of day does not affect heat/ sun exposure.
